In 2011, California adopted a Renewable Portfolio Standard (RPS) requiring that at least one-third of the state’s electricity come from clean energy sources by 2020. The California RPS program was established in 2002 by Senate Bill (SB) 1078 (Sher, 2002) with the initial requirement that 20% of. Interconnection standards define how a distributed generation system, such as solar photovoltaics (PVs), can connect to the grid. Technical specifications of solar container power station monitoring system

Technical specifications of solar container power station monitoring system

These stations are standardized, stocked, follow the industry requirements of IEC 61724-1:2021, and exceed IEC 61000-4-5 Class 4 surge immunity levels. Station installation is made easy via pile-mountable hardware and an all-new web user interface (UI). The Rockwell Automation Solar Power Field Monitoring System provides SCADA functionality to integrate solar generating capacity into a centralized monitoring system. The system is easily customized with accessories for additional measurements, wireless communications, and remote operation.
